Number of Atoms in a Coin
The density of iron is 7.87 g/cm³, and the average mass for one iron atom is 9.28×10-23 g.
Six identical iron coins are found to displace a total of 1.80 mL of water when immersed in a graduated cylinder containing water.
How many atoms are present in one such iron coin?
